TSA Fairy Dust Favia Coral
Overview
Fairy Dust Favia Coral shows tight polygonal corallites with small, contrasting mouths and a speckled surface. Favites pentagona is a stony, encrusting to domed brain coral; it does well under moderate light and moderate, indirect water flow. It is photosynthetic via symbiotic algae but accepts small meaty foods at night, which can support faster growth and stronger color. Place with space from neighbors, as sweeper tentacles can sting nearby corals.

Why is my Fairy Dust Favia’s color fading under seemingly good light?
Favites pentagona prefers moderate PAR (80–150) with a blue-heavy spectrum; too much white or PAR >180 often washes out fluorescence. Keep nutrients non-zero (nitrate 5–15 ppm, phosphate 0.03–0.1), and feed small meaty foods at night to fuel pigments. Stability matters—alk swings flatten color fast. Check for light shock if recently moved; acclimate over 1–2 weeks. -
How aggressive is Fairy Dust Favia, and how much space should I give it?
At night it extends short, sticky sweepers—typically 1–2 inches, sometimes more after heavy feeding. Provide 2–3 inches of buffer from fleshy LPS, a bit less from hardy encrusters. Indirect, moderate flow reduces mucus buildup and sting strength. Avoid placing next to thin-tissued chalices or acans; this coral usually wins slow standoffs. -
Will Favites pentagona grow as an encruster or a dome, and how can I guide its shape?
It typically encrusts first, then forms a low dome of tightly packed, shared-wall corallites. To keep it plating low, mount on a wide, flat tile and maintain moderate flow; for a taller dome, give a smaller pedestal. Growth improves with alk 8–9 dKH, Ca ~420, Mg ~1300, and steady nutrients. Avoid frequent fragging that interrupts skeletal build-up. -
I see tissue receding along the valleys—what causes this and how do I stop it?
Common triggers are stagnant debris, vermetid snail irritation, alk swings, or early brown jelly. Increase indirect flow, baste detritus, and remove vermetids. Verify alk stability and non-zero nutrients. If jelly appears, isolate, perform an iodine or low-dose peroxide dip, and trim dead tissue. Afterward, reduce light slightly and feed lightly at night to aid recovery.
